Bhubaneswar: After undergoing medical treatment in Mumbai, Biju Janata Dal (BJD) Supremo and Leader of Opposition Naveen Patnaik is all set to return to Odisha today. He is scheduled to arrive at Bhubaneswar Airport at 11 am.
As per reports, Naveen Patnaik had travelled to Mumbai on June 20 for cervical spondylosis treatment and underwent surgery at Kokilaben Dhirubhai Ambani Hospital on June 22. He was discharged from the hospital on July 7 after a successful surgery.
During his absence, BJD senior vice-president Debi Prasad Mishra was handling the party’s organisational responsibilities.
Naveen Patnaik had issued a notice, instructing the party’s political affairs committee to manage the party’s affairs in his absence.
